2.3 Core Skills Every Beginner Should Master

Guides from Maggie Frames and Tough Kitten Crafts highlight these fundamentals:

  • Machine threading and understanding the thread path
  • Needle selection (75/11 embroidery needles are a common start)
  • Tension adjustment to avoid thread breaks and ensure clean stitches
  • Stabilizer selection: tear-away, cut-away, or water-soluble based on fabric
  • Test stitching on scrap fabric before the final piece
  • Tool familiarity across machine, threads, stabilizers, and accessories

4.1 Machines and Hoops: Entry-Level to Professional

Two popular machines illustrate how gear affects your workflow:

  • Brother PE800: Single-needle, beginner-friendly with a 5×7 inch hoop for small logos, patches, and starter projects.
  • Brother Innov-is NQ1600E: Mid-tier model with 5×7 and 6×10 hoops, faster stitching, and automatic jump stitch cutting for larger designs and efficient production.

Hoop sizing considerations: Larger hoops (e.g., 6×10 or 5×12 multi-positional) enable bigger designs without rehooping, while smaller hoops excel at precision and tight spaces. Materials vary from plastic to wood; wooden hoops often provide superior tension for delicate fabrics. For practical selection and setup, explore embroidery machine hoops as you plan project sizes.

4.2 Threads, Stabilizers, and Fabric Selection

The right thread-stabilizer-fabric combo is essential for crisp, vibrant results.

Threads:

Type Fiber Weight Best For Limitations
Rayon Viscose 30–40 Decorative, shiny finishes Fades with UV exposure
Polyester Synthetic 30–40 Durable, frequent washing Less soft than rayon
Cotton Natural 30–50 Quilts, matte look, hand-embroidery Lower tensile strength

Stabilizers:

Type Use Case Example
Tear-Away Stable fabrics (cotton, linen) Iron-On Tear-Away
Cut-Away Stretchy fabrics (knits, fleece) Fusible Polymesh
Self-Adhesive Easy removal, minimal residue Sticky Peel N Stick
Fusible Appliqué backing, interfacing Heat N Bond Lite

Water-soluble toppings help dense stitching sit cleanly on the surface. Start practice on cotton, linen, or muslin; avoid delicate silks or loose weaves until you’ve dialed in stabilizers and tension. Always test on scrap before stitching the final piece. Small tools that matter: disappearing ink pens, chalk markers, embroidery snips, pinking shears, seam rippers, mini irons, and software like Embrilliance for editing and converting embroidery files.

7.1 Specialized Operation and Digitization Courses

Standard curricula often underemphasize hands-on troubleshooting and maintenance. Practical modules should cover diagnosing tension issues, replacing needles, stabilizer selection by fabric, and routine calibration. On the software side, advanced training should go beyond basics into efficient stitch planning, color management, file optimization, and the role of AI-assisted design and cloud collaboration.

Recommended curriculum elements:

  • Troubleshooting workshops (thread breaks, puckering, alignment)
  • Machine maintenance modules (calibration, needles, fabric-specific stabilizing)
  • Deep dives into digitizing software (Hatch, InkStitch, Wilcom) and emerging tools
  • Industrial workflow insights (scheduling, bulk production, quality control)

9. Machine Embroidery Class FAQ

9.1 Q: What are the prerequisites for machine embroidery classes?

A: Most beginner classes require no prior experience. You’ll need access to a basic embroidery machine, a hoop, threads, stabilizers, and fabric. Some advanced courses recommend familiarity with basic operation or introductory software skills.

9.2 Q: What types of practice projects are common in classes?

A: Typical projects include monograms, simple motifs, greeting cards, drawstring bags, and small home décor. These reinforce hooping, thread selection, and design transfer while building confidence.

9.3 Q: Where can I find troubleshooting resources for common embroidery issues?

A: Many online platforms provide guides on thread breaks, puckering, and alignment. Manufacturers and software providers also offer forums, tutorials, and manuals for resolving technical challenges.

9.4 Q: How can I choose the right class for my skill level?

A: Assess your experience, learning style, and goals. Beginners benefit from structured, hands-on classes with guided projects; advanced users should seek digitization, multi-needle workflow, and industrial process modules. Reviews and course descriptions help you find the best fit.
